No Fear of The Day of Judgment

THE HOLY BIBLE (New Living Translation – 1 John 4:16-19): 16 ….God is love, and all who live in love live in God, and God lives in them. 17 And as we live in God, our love grows more perfect. So we will not be afraid on the Day of Judgment, but we can face him with confidence because we live like Jesus here in this world. 18 Such love has no fear, because perfect love expels all fear. If we are afraid, it is for fear of punishment, and this shows that we have not fully experienced his perfect love. 19 We love each other because he loved us first.

THOUGHTS: If we are faced with a court case, we will no doubt live in fear of the outcome, especially on the day that the Judge concludes the case and issues the sentence. If we are summoned to the boss’s office at work, our natural tendency is to well up in fear, as our first reaction is to question in our minds if we have done anything wrong. In our daily walk here on earth, whether we know Jesus personally or not, we live in hopes that our lives would not be in vain, but instead, a blessing to someone else. For those who have invited Jesus into their heart, we live each day praying that we would please God in the way that we live, in total harmony with Him, and in total obedience to all that He has commanded in His Word. John summarizes this for us in these verses today, by saying that we must live in love, for as we do, we will live in the image of God, who loved us sacrificially and unconditionally, in spite of who we were in character and entrenched in sin. When we make it our mission to live like Jesus taught us, our love becomes more perfect (more like the love expressed by Jesus, and expected by Him of us). And when this occurs, we live with a clear conscience and without fear of the Day of Judgment when we stand before Jesus. You see, ‘Judgment’ can result in one of two types of emotion for us: Gladness/happiness/joy as we are declared ‘not guilty of the crime, or sin; or sadness/disappointment/rejection/fear as we are found guilty of the crime, or sinful and without a Savior. Love – A Self-Evaluating Tool

THE HOLY BIBLE (The Message – 1 John 4:8-11): 8–10 The person who refuses to love doesn’t know the first thing about God, because God is love—so you can’t know him if you don’t love. This is how God showed his love for us: God sent his only Son into the world so we might live through him. This is the kind of love we are talking about—not that we once upon a time loved God, but that he loved us and sent his Son as a sacrifice to clear away our sins and the damage they’ve done to our relationship with God.11–12 My dear, dear friends, if God loved us like this, we certainly ought to love each other. No one has seen God, ever. But if we love one another, God dwells deeply within us, and his love becomes complete in us—perfect love!

THOUGHTS: Sometimes, people go to great extremes to determine, or prove who they are, or where they may have come from. I’ve especially heard of grown-up children having a DNA test done to help them determine who their father is, for they want to be identifiable with a birth mother and father. John laid out some tests that we could perform to help us identify to whom we belong, beyond the tests of physical parents and/or children, and this all evolves around one key characteristic – ‘LOVE’. He first demonstrates the true meaning of this word by showing us how much God loved/loves us. Imagine for a moment that you have just been told of God. One of the first things you may hear about is His amazing, unconditional love for you. But to take it one step further into the amazing explanation of God’s love is to learn about Him sacrificing His One and Only Son to die for us, so that we may have the means to eternal salvation with the God of this universe. Now, understand that at the time God did this, everyone in the world was underserving of this awesome love, as you might be at this time. Yet God did this out of pure love for us! So now, put that into perspective. Those who have accepted the gift of God (Jesus, His Son) – our directive is that we imitate His love as we interact with Him and/or others in this world. Evidence Of Whose We Are

THE HOLY BIBLE (New Living Translation – 1 John 3:9-10): 9 Those who have been born into God’s family do not make a practice of sinning, because God’s life is in them. So they can’t keep on sinning, because they are children of God. 10 So now we can tell who are children of God and who are children of the devil. Anyone who does not live righteously and does not love other believers does not belong to God.

THOUGHTS: I remember at one point in my life I was at a gas station pumping gas, when suddenly someone called me by my dad’s name. My head quickly popped up to see who knew my family. Apparently there was enough facial resemblance, or actions, to remind the person of something he had seen in my dad! I find it exciting when I walk away from a sales clerk knowing that they must be a brother or sister, because their actions, their concern, their unselfish care for me as a customer, were all indicators that they must share the same faith that I do, and have the same Father that I have learned about over the years from His handbook, the Bible. Friends there are a few tests in these verses today that I would encourage you to use as a self-examination tool:

  1. Do not make a practice of sinning – When we invite Jesus into our hearts and lives as our Savior and Lord, not only does He forgive us of our sin, but He shows us a new way to live – like Him. Through His example, we are guided and encouraged to live holy lives, even as He is holy. To depend on the power within (the Holy Spirit) to prevent us from performing the same sin that we may have committed without thought, prior to our conversion;
  2. Do not keep on sinning – Very similar to the above, but the difference is that once we have been prompted by the Holy Spirit to stop doing something that He considers sin, we are to make every effort to not repeat that sin. We must not let it rule us. God’s Holy Spirit cannot reside where sin abides!
  3. Live righteously – Live our lives ‘right with God’. We are shown throughout the Bible what God expects of us – what is right and what is wrong. With the awesome power of the Holy Spirit, we are to live our lives ‘right with God’!
  4. Love other believers – We are to live life expressing our love and concern for each other, even if they don’t love us back, or show any appreciation for what we do for them. Sadly there is a saying that “Christians in particular, tend to shoot their wounded”. We are taught in this scripture that when the world sees us loving each other, they will know that we are different and controlled by a greater power. Selfishness and Satan-led malice, jealousy or envy will eat up our desire to love like Jesus did. The power of the Holy Spirit within us will help us to love even those who despitefully use us.

Friends, living like I described above will help us to internalize whether we truly did commit to accepting, loving, serving and practicing the love of God. It will also help confirm to the world that we are who we say we are. However, please remember that God knows our heart, so He knows whether we honestly dedicated our lives to Him. I believe He is ashamed when we act up, but our outward actions only influences the world, they’re not needed to prove anything to God.

Why Christians Are Left In Satan’s Domain

THE HOLY BIBLE (The Message – 1 John 2:15-17): Don’t love the world’s ways. Don’t love the world’s goods. Love of the world squeezes out love for the Father. Practically everything that goes on in the world—wanting your own way, wanting everything for yourself, wanting to appear important—has nothing to do with the Father. It just isolates you from him. The world and all its wanting, wanting, wanting is on the way out—but whoever does what God wants is set for eternity.

THOUGHTS: We know that the evil one is not a friend of God’s children, and that he will do everything possible to trip us up and cause us to fall flat on our faces, and fail miserably on our walk with Christ, that we committed to when we accepted Him as Lord and Savior. Would it not make sense then, that if we dislike and despise the evil one, that we should also do the same in regards to his domain – the place where he hangs out? As I read the surrounding verses, I believe the Holy Spirit caused me to question: Why then are we left here in Satan’s domain after we commit our lives to Jesus Christ? I believe that the biggest reason is that since Jesus had to come and speak to us here in this domain, why should we be exempted from the same trials and temptations that He faced? I cannot imagine what this earth would look like if all Christians were pulled out of it, for we are to give balance to the evil that is led by Satan. We are to show ‘right’ (the ways of God), when it seems like only wrong prevails. We are to show hope (the hope of our living, loving and saving Lord), when it seems like everything around is doomed for death and failure. We are to show peace and love (the uncompromising, unconditional love of Jesus Christ) for everyone, not just for those that the world can easily find in their hearts to love. We are to demonstrate our satisfaction with what we have, solely in the precious gift of Jesus Christ, and that having more ‘stuff’, or money, or larger homes and/or cars is in no way a necessity, nor a requirement for our happiness, for our joy comes in the morning – the first day for all eternity in heaven with our Master, our Lord and our Savior! So we have responsibilities on earth to be representatives of the King, not to feel like we need any part of what it has to offer. Remember, it is Satan’s domain, and everything in it is influenced by him, for his glory. We are to look to our King, and no one else friend! We are to be His representatives under every circumstance in life friend! We are to appear as light, when it seems like there is only darkness friend!

Proof That You Truly Know God

THE HOLY BIBLE (New Living Translation – 1 John 2:3-6): 3 … we can be sure that we know him if we obey his commandments. 4 If someone claims, “I know God,” but doesn’t obey God’s commandments, that person is a liar and is not living in the truth. 5 But those who obey God’s word truly show how completely they love him. That is how we know we are living in him. 6 Those who say they live in God should live their lives as Jesus did.

THOUGHTS: Obedience reveals commitment to Christ! In fact, this is a good test for yourself: If you find yourself generally at odds with obeying the Word of God and His commands, then it is time for a self-examination and a humbleness before God, asking Him to reveal the area(s) of your life that you need to recommit to Him and/or realign with His will. When you feel unloved by God, or distanced from Him, then according to John 15:10 there may be areas of your life where you have taken personal control and no longer allow God full control. Friends, I believe there are several keywords that are important in this fact finding, internal evaluation: Think about ‘hypocritical’ – for you are saying that you love God and know Him intimately, yet doing your own thing and ignoring His commands. This is very damaging to your witness to others; Think about ‘lying’ – for you are saying with your mouth that you know God but really ignoring His commands. Verse 4 plainly spells this one out for us; Think about ‘untrustworthy’ – for how can God or man trust someone who cannot be trusted to live as he claims to be?
